What is Primetable?

Primetable helps members discover last-minute availability at some of London's best and hardest-to-book restaurants. Instead of constantly checking restaurant booking sites or waiting for cancellations, members use Primetable to spot premium table openings faster and act the moment desirable availability appears.

How does Primetable help me get better restaurant bookings in London?

Primetable surfaces high-quality restaurant availability as tables open up, especially at popular London restaurants that are often fully booked at peak times. It saves members time by reducing the need to manually check multiple booking platforms, restaurant websites and waiting lists throughout the day.

Does Primetable guarantee a table?

No. Primetable does not guarantee restaurant bookings, because availability changes quickly and restaurants control their own tables. Primetable helps members discover and respond to premium availability faster, but you may still need to complete the reservation through the restaurant or its booking provider.

How is Primetable different from a restaurant waiting list?

A restaurant waiting list usually applies to a single venue and depends on that restaurant contacting you. Primetable is broader: it helps members discover availability across a curated set of London restaurants, giving you a faster, simpler way to see when desirable tables become available.
